Shenkar College is a leading Israeli institution that merges engineering, design, and art within a compact, urban campus in Ramat Gan. Founded in 1970 and publicly funded since 1983, it has evolved from a textile-focused school into a multidisciplinary powerhouse recognized by the Council for Higher Education. Its diverse faculties enroll thousands of students who benefit from a culture that values experimentation, cross-disciplinary collaboration, and industry-relevant innovation.
The college’s legacy is tied to Arieh Shenkar, a pioneer of Israel’s textile sector, and today it continues to produce graduates who contribute to global industries. With advanced R&D facilities and a mission centered on integrating creativity with technology, Shenkar remains a top choice for students seeking meaningful, future-oriented education.

Student Life & Campus Experience at Shenkar College of Engineering and Design

Shenkar’s campus provides a vibrant and collaborative environment across modern and historic buildings, including the EcoTubes Workshop Building and the renovated Bauhaus-style Elite structure. Facilities feature advanced labs, spacious studios, digital resources, and communal areas designed to encourage creativity and interaction. Students benefit from accessible spaces, a well-equipped library, cafeterias, and a dynamic campus hub for study and social activities.
Student life is enriched by associations representing art, design, engineering, and entrepreneurship. Events, exhibitions, competitions, and workshops foster cultural and academic engagement. Support services—such as the HILA Center, counseling resources, and student-led initiatives—ensure a well-rounded, supportive campus experience.

Student FAQ - Shenkar College of Engineering and Design

What languages are programs taught in? Most undergraduate programs are taught in Hebrew, while several graduate tracks include English instruction or support. International students receive assistance to integrate academically and socially.
Are scholarships available? Yes. Financial aid is provided through the Dean of Students Office and HILA Center, offering need-based and merit-based support to help reduce educational costs.
How does Shenkar prepare students for careers? Career development is supported through ACT’s mentorship, industry-linked projects, internships, and counseling services, ensuring that students graduate with strong professional portfolios and connections.
Admissions & Pratical Information at Shenkar College of Engineering and Design

Undergraduate admissions require matriculation, aptitude tests, and portfolios for design and art programs, while engineering tracks emphasize math and physics credentials. Graduate applicants submit relevant degrees, portfolios, and additional materials depending on specialization. Applications are submitted online, with most programs beginning in October. Tuition is subsidized for Israeli students, while international tuition ranges between USD 5,000–8,000.
While Shenkar does not offer on-campus housing, support is available for locating accommodation in Ramat Gan and Tel Aviv. Orientation sessions, visa assistance, and onboarding through the Meydanet app help students settle in smoothly and navigate campus resources with ease.
